Least Common Multiple of 96471 and 96490 with GCF Formula

The formula of LCM is LCM(a,b) = ( a × b) / GCF(a,b).
We need to calculate greatest common factor 96471 and 96490, than apply into the LCM equation.

GCF(96471,96490) = 1
LCM(96471,96490) = ( 96471 × 96490) / 1
LCM(96471,96490) = 9308486790 / 1
LCM(96471,96490) = 9308486790
